TRIAD reconciliation for import electricity

Pylon 450x300.jpg

TRIAD costs can be a separate line (also referred to as TNUOS) on your bill if you have a flexible electricity supply contract. If so, it is likely that you pay a bit towards your TRIAD costs every month based on the costs that your electricity supplier think you will incur. Now the actual winter 20-21 TRIAD times and dates are known you will likely receive a separate TRIAD reconciliation statement or even just an extra line on your bill somewhere that can easily be missed. It’s worth keeping an eye out for to make sure it is correct.
